WebThese include the UK Cod Avoidance Plan and the EU Fishing Opportunities regulation (2024/109): Closed areas for all or part of the year in Norway and Scotland to protect spawning and juvenile cod. Gear restrictions to reduce catches of juvenile cod. There are exemptions for trawling in mud, where smaller meshes are used to catch Nephrops. Web13 jan. 2024 · Measures to protect spawning cod in the Firth of Clyde for the past 20 years will continue in 2024 and 2024, through the seasonal closure (between 14 February and … WebCod were found to prefer areas with temperatures around 5–7°C for spawning and there was a general preference for high salinity waters. Seabed conditions also affected spawning distribution with cod selecting coarse sand and avoiding areas of very high tidal flow. Web24 sep. 2024 · The plan aimed to reduce cod catches by 25 per cent in 2009, followed by subsequent annual reductions of 10 per cent. In response, the Scottish industry closed large spawning areas to fishing, trialled new nets and a system of remote electronic monitoring using CCTV cameras on board boats.

There is a UK North Sea cod avoidance plan, requiring a minimum 120mm mesh size in the Scottish North Sea, seasonal closures to protect spawning stocks, and a requirement to move away from areas where large numbers of cod are observed in catches.

Web20 jan. 2024 · This Order prohibits all methods of fishing within specified areas of the Firth of Clyde from 14 February to 30 April, during both 2024 and 2024 (articles 1 (3) and 3). The Order remains in force until the end of 30 April 2024. The Order applies only to British fishing boats. Since 2001, a specific area in the Firth of Clyde has been closed to ...
